Genesys Spine is launching the TiLock Cortical Spinal System, offering midline screw placement with a medial/lateral trajectory to provide an anatomy-conserving alternative to traditional pedicular fixation.
TiLock’s tapered, self drilling/tapping feature is designed to offer an easy entry and transition into a Corticocancellous thread form to support fixation. A reduced tulip head profile allows for screw placement with nominal bone removal.
Genesys received FDA 510(k) clearance for its first product, the TiLock Pedicle Screw, in 2010.
